At Xe, we live currencies. We provide a comprehensive range of currency services and products, including our Currency Converter, Market Analysis, Currency Data API and quick, easy, secure Money Transfers for individuals and businesses. We leverage technology to deliver these services through our website, mobile app and by phone. Last year, we helped over 300 million people access information about the currencies that matter to them and over 225,000 people used us to send money overseas.

ABOUT THIS ROLE
We’re looking for a data-driven, results-oriented Product Manager to join our team in Denver. You will be responsible for driving the execution of the team’s roadmap for millions of users worldwide. You will partner with technology, design, and marketing to evolve the riamoneytransfer.com experience and contribute to product features that generate customer and business value. ROLES & R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Own it from kickoff to launch: You’ll help translate partner agreements into clear, actionable product plans. You’ll work closely with the SVP of Business Development to clarify requirements, coordinate internal teams, and deliver smooth launches that meet partner expectations.

  • Productize the integration layer: Build reusable components, configuration tools, and internal dashboards that reduce developer dependency and accelerate onboarding of new partners.

  • Invest in tooling for scale: Develop a toolkit to support long-tail partners, making it increasingly easy to integrate with minimal engineering involvement.

  • Architect great experiences: Help partners launch white-labeled flows that feel native to their product while preserving Ria’s reliability, compliance, and conversion performance.

  • Coordinate across disciplines: You’ll work with business development, solutions engineering, compliance, and product/tech leads—sometimes asynchronously—to keep initiatives moving and unblock issues.

  • Use data to drive decisions: Ensure we’re instrumented, tracked, and learning from every integration. Post-launch, help optimize adoption and retention.

POSITION REQUIREMENTS

  • You’ve shipped partner-integrated products before, like SDKs, white-label flows, or APIs, and you're comfortable navigating the complexity and coordination they require.

  • You take initiative and follow through. You work proactively to keep things moving and know when to escalate or step in to resolve issues.

  • You have enough technical fluency to work with engineers and ask the right questions (SDK auth flows, client vs server state, tracking, etc).

  • You care about the end user and can advocate for a strong user experience, even in B2B2C contexts.

  • You write clearly and manage stakeholders without creating noise.

  • You have 3+ years of experience in fintech, SaaS, platforms, or embedded services. Startup or scale-up background is a plus.
